The renaissance of fluorescence resonance energy transfer

Nat Struct Biol. 2000 Sep;7(9):730-4. doi: 10.1038/78948.

Abstract

Recent advances in fluorescence resonance energy transfer have led to qualitative and quantitative improvements in the technique, including increased spatial resolution, distance range, and sensitivity. These advances, due largely to new fluorescent dyes, but also to new optical methods and instrumentation, have opened up new biological applications.
